Why You Should Consider Mental Health Services in Ira, IA
Mental health rehab is beneficial for the individuals suffering, as well as the society as a whole. Mental illness negatively impacts our brain, and our brain is where we experience all of our thoughts, feelings, and emotions. It can therefore be inferred that we have to prioritize our Mental Health as good if not better than our physical well-being. In the absence of mental health services, recovery is not easy. This is particularly true when factoring in substance use. research has demonstrated that most people who struggle with substance abuse suffer from a dual diagnosis (Mental Illness). {Hence, one of the explainations as to why relapse rates in recovering individuals is so high. When we care for the addiction to drugs or alcohol without the underlying Mental Illness, we are merely removing the crutch without fixing the broken leg.
Paying for Ira Mental Health Care
Paying for mental health rehab is going to look different for each person, depending on their financial situation. First would be speaking with your insurance provider and having them provide recommendations based on your healthcare plan’s coverage. Option 2 is out-of-pocket payment. This is a typical option for people who select a mental health rehab not covered by their insurance, or when they do not have health insurance. The final option would be to search for a state-funded program if you are uninsured or lack the financial means to pay privately.
